DUICUO

長年続いている格闘ゲーム「Overgrowth (Revenge Fighting Rabbit 2)」がオープンソース プロジェクトとして発表されました。

4月21日、発売から10年以上経つ格闘ゲーム『Overgrowth』がオープンソース化することを正式に発表した。

Overgrowth(中国語名:仇抗斗兔2)は、Wolfre Gamesが開発したアクションアドベンチャーゲームです。ゲームプレイはアサシン クリードに似ていますが、プレイヤーは筋肉質なウサギを操作し、他の動物と戦います。それぞれの動物には、猫(移動速度が速い)、犬(体力が高い、暗殺されない)、ネズミ(攻撃速度が速いが脆い)、オオカミ(体力が高い、暗殺されない、攻撃はガード不能、非常に高いダメージを与える)など、独自の特性があります。このゲームの大きな特徴は、非常にリアルな物理エンジンです。このエンジンによって戦闘エフェクトがリアルタイムでレンダリングされ、非常にリアルな衝撃フィードバックが得られます。

Overgrowthは2011年に初リリースされましたが、実際の開発には14年を要しました。今回のオープンソースリリースには、ゲーム全体のフレームワークコードが含まれていますが、アートアセットやレベルコンテンツは含まれていません。Wolfre氏によると、これは悪質な企業がOvergrowthをリファクタリングして自社製品として転売するのを防ぐためです。実際、このゲームは主に以下のユーザーのためにオープンソース化されています。

  • ゲーム公開プロジェクトの完全なフレームワークを理解するには、具体的に何から構成されているのでしょうか?
  • アニメーション システムなど、ゲームの特定の機能のコードを理解したいです。
  • OvergrowthのMODをもっと作りたいプレイヤー

このゲームはApache 2.0ライセンスに基づくオープンソースで、コードはGitHubのovergrowthリポジトリに保存され、WolfordコミュニティとLugaru OSSプロジェクト(Revenge Fighting Bunny 1)の開発者によってメンテナンスされています。オープンソースであることに加え、ゲームの価格も30ドルから3分の1の20ドルに値下げされました。

さらに、Wolford氏は開発者に対し、Overgrowthの物理エンジンは時代遅れであることを改めて指摘しています。この点を認識しておくことは重要ですが、新規プロジェクトには推奨されません。新しいゲームを開発するには、Godotなど、より現代的なゲームエンジンの選択肢が数多くあります。

この記事はOSCHINAから転載したものです。

記事タイトル: ベテラン格闘ゲームOvergrowth(リベンジファイティングラビット2)がオープンソースを発表

この記事は以下でご覧いただけます: https://www.oschina.net/news/192844/overgrowth-open-source-announcement